OriginPro 8 distinguished itself from the base "Origin" version by including advanced statistics: one-way and two-way repeated measures ANOVA, nonparametric tests (Mann-Whitney, Wilcoxon), and survival analysis (Kaplan-Meier). For the first time, a biologist could run a post-hoc Tukey test directly in the same environment where they plotted their dose-response curves. 📊 Origin vs
